What is the Protection of Personal and Property Rights Act?
The Protection of Personal and Property Rights Act safeguards individuals who are unable to manage their personal care, welfare, or property due to incapacity. It covers a wide range of situations, including the Court appointing a property administrator or property manager to manage someone’s finances. A property administrator order is only granted if the subject person’s assets and income or benefit is under a prescribed amount. For all individuals who have property or income over that threshold, a property manager order is required which has additional obligations to report to the Court.

What does the new Protection of Personal and Property Rights Order 2024 do?
The 2024 update to the Protection of Personal and Property Rights Act raises the threshold from 3 October 2024. From this date, the prescribed amount of any one item of property owned by the subject person is $25,000 and the amount of any income or benefit is $38,800. These thresholds are now also increased annually from 1 April 2025.

Who does it affect?
This legislation is especially important for families with elderly members, individuals with disabilities, or anyone at risk of losing decision-making capacity. It enables appointed representatives to make important decisions on behalf of those who need support. Until this law change, anyone receiving superannuation or a benefit was likely above the prescribed threshold for a property administrator order, meaning that the application for a property manager order was required even if the subject person had minimal income or assets.
